Abstract :
Similarity measure among ship maintenance cost cases plays an important role in cost forecasting. A combined fuzzy clustering algorithm which integrates fuzzy transitive closure method and fuzzy c-means method is proposed to deal with this problem. In order to improve the performance of the combined algorithm, a weighted cosine distance method is also put forward to establish a more reasonable fuzzy similar matrix. The experiments show that the proposed fuzzy clustering algorithm can greatly improve the quality of case retrieval. The application of the combined algorithm is feasible and effective.
